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62099 465 68105
65 100053 224240
65 100053 224240
0567019437 2617114 7557
All about undefined
Interested in learning more?
65 100053 224240
0567019437 2617114 7557
See more
279701 8499282459
116331 247 8677816
See more
13673 34342
48506 8497 32
See more